Nilanga Assembly Election Result 2019

Maharashtra · Vidhan Sabha (State Assembly) Election 2019

Nilangekar Sambhaji Diliprao Patil of Bharatiya Janta Party won the Nilanga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ency in Maharashtra in the 2019 state assembly election, securing 97,324 votes (49.60% vote share). The runner-up was Ashokrao Shivajirao Patil Nilangekar (Indian National Congress) with 65,193 votes.

A total of 10 candidates contested this assembly seat. Position Candidate Name Votes Votes% Party
1 Nilangekar Sambhaji Diliprao Patil 97324 49.60% Bharatiya Janta Party
2 Ashokrao Shivajirao Patil Nilangekar 65193 33.30% Indian National Congress
3 Arvind Virbhadrappa Bhatambre 29819 15.20% Vanchit Bahujan Aaghadi
4 Kamble Rajaram Vitthal 907 0.50% Bahujan Samaj Party
5 Sastapure Rajkumar Vitthal 652 0.30% Independent
6 Shrimant Niwant Usnale 641 0.30% Independent
7 Ankushrao Shivajirao Patil Honalikar 478 0.20% Rashtriya Maratha Party
8 Anwarkhan Sattarkhan Pathan 438 0.20% Independent
9 Shesherao Rama Kamble 345 0.20% Independent
10 Rameshwar Baburao Suryanwashi 249 0.10% Bahujan Vikas Aaghadi
